The Midlife Plot Twist Podcast
What if the life you built no longer fits? Join Jennifer — academic, coach, and woman in her 40s — as she shares her real-time journey from burnout to breakthrough. Honest, insightful, and a little messy, each episode explores what it really takes to let go of old identities and create a midlife that feels true, purposeful, and free.

In this episode, Jennifer explores midlife acceptance and what it means to embrace aging as a woman in her forties without shame, fear, or the pressure to stay young. She reflects on the identities and beliefs that delayed her connection to midlife, including career transitions, body image, menopause, aging, and living out of sync with peers. Drawing from personal experiences with loss, health challenges, and self-reflection, she shares five practices that have supported her journey toward self-acceptance and emotional well-being in midlife. This episode offers an honest, compassionate conversation for women navigating midlife transitions, identity, self-worth, and personal growth.

In this episode of The Midlife Plot Twist podcast, Jennifer shares a pivotal moment in her midlife journey as she awaits the results of her graduate school application, which is one step toward fulfilling a dream she’s carried since adolescence: becoming a therapist.
She reflects on how her path through academia, coaching, and creative rediscovery led her back to the dreams that shaped her early life, and how midlife is often the perfect time to revisit what once inspired us. Jennifer explores the idea of enduring dreams, the role of intuition in life transitions, the transferable skills we accumulate without realizing it, and the deep connection between self-worth and the courage to pursue what we truly want.
This episode invites listeners to reflect on their own long-held dreams, the essence behind them, and the possibility of bringing them back into their lives—no matter how much time has passed.

In this episode, Jennifer talks about what the plot twist means to her adn dives into one of the most powerful emotions we can face in midlife: fear. What happens when a life you’ve worked so hard to build suddenly stops feeling like your story?
Jennifer shares her personal experience of confronting fear during a major change in life, exploring how catastrophizing can trap us in black-and-white thinking and how reclaiming choice, which is guided by our own well-being, can free us. Through honest reflection, she reveals how fear has shown up at every major turning point in her life, and how she’s learned to see it as a companion in transformation rather than an enemy to avoid.
If you’ve ever felt paralyzed by fear while facing a life change, this episode will help you reframe it as a sign of growth and possibility.

In this episode of The Midlife Plot Twist, Jennifer opens up about what it feels like to navigate midlife as a woman in her forties, from confronting fears about leaving her academic career to redefining what aging means after major life and health changes. She shares how a hysterectomy became an unexpected doorway to self-discovery and how midlife, once associated with loss, is revealing itself as a time of clarity, courage, and liberation. Through honest reflection, Jennifer explores the myths we’ve been taught about midlife and the freedom that comes from finally meeting yourself without apology. This conversation is an invitation to see midlife not as an ending, but as the start of something powerful and new.
